Brown Rice

Moderate — Brown Rice is neutral for fat-burning.

Extra fiber and intact bran slow digestion versus white rice.

The breakdown

Per serving: 1 cup cooked (150g)

Glycemic load
28
Sugar (g)
0
Fiber (g)
4
Protein (g)
5

Glycemic index 68 · Carbs 45g · Fat 2g · Processing minimal

What this means for fat-burning

A FatTonic Score of 40 places brown rice in the Moderate band. The score is dominated by its glycemic load of 28 (high — a steep glucose and insulin response).

The fiber slows digestion and blunts the insulin response.
